Transaction 109b1f22f925926aa3816cfcfd80ee12a62bab77819c88d9aa33ea48b23798cb
1 Input
1 Output
-
109b1f22f925926aa3816cfcfd80ee12a62bab77819c88d9aa33ea48b23798cb:0
- value
- 590997
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da158d54c8be65e46b8d9cd1e7e47b301fdaba88 OP_EQUAL
- address
- 3Ma93pvyMRwrkLDjv3FVeLEAVNyR54kZsP